How come when I sleep while burning incense I have vivid dreams?
Usually, when I sleep I don't have any dreams or I can't remember them. I would say 8/10 times when I burn incense when I lay down to go to sleep in an attempt to relax myself, I have very vivid and colorful dreams, and can remember pretty much all of them. Some are so vivid it almost seems real at the time (which is quite nice I might add, when you're having a really good one, until the alarm clock goes off.)
So is there some sort of connection? I'm only guessing but is it because you are using your sense of smell you are partially kept awake while sleeping? I don't know much about aroma therapy, and can't find any answers about this, if I type it in google I only get witches and spells and stuff like that. I'm wondering if there is a natural (physical) connection, since I don't believe in spirits and all that jazz.
